EDITOR NOTES

The sister-site twin, where the game choice is the only real lever

The first thing I noticed testing this was that Uptown Pokies delivers exactly what its sister Uptown Aces does — JUN10BOOST credited the 10 spins within a few minutes, no deposit, with the same three-game choice at claim. The terms are identical down to the $180 cap and the 60x, so there's nothing to separate the two on the offer itself; the only reason to pick one over the other is which account you'd rather hold. What carries across is the same structural tension: a generous $180 ceiling sitting on just 10 spins at a steep 60x, which makes the cap a distant ceiling rather than a target. 10 spins return a few dollars on average, and 60x on those few dollars exhausts the balance before the requirement completes on most claims.

What I'd want a reader to catch is that, with the offer fixed, the game choice is the only lever that affects the outcome. The three eligible slots — Devil's Jackpot, T-Rex Lava Blitz, or Blazing Horse — differ in variance and feature payout, and on a 10-spin chip the realistic value comes entirely from triggering a feature within those spins. That makes the higher-variance option with the more rewarding bonus the rational pick: you're buying one or two shots at a feature round, so the game whose feature pays biggest gives the best access to the cap. The 60x math is identical whichever you choose — $10 of winnings clears at $600 of bets, $24 of expected loss at 96% RTP. Comparable no-deposit casino bonuses with larger counts give more realistic access to a high cap.

The window and the cashout gate are the same as the sister site's. The promo runs June 18 to 30, just under two weeks, and a validating deposit is conventionally required before a no-deposit cashout processes at this operator tier — so verify that before treating the $180 as reachable money. Since the chip is identical across the pair, claiming at both Uptown Pokies and Uptown Aces would mean two separate accounts rather than a doubled prize, and sister-site groups typically restrict consecutive free-bonus stacking — so treat it as one chip at whichever account suits you. Enter JUN10BOOST, pick the game for the feature, and treat the $180 as a long shot.
